How make a career in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ator

A career as a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ator offers a unique opportunity to contribute to the growth and management of real estate assets, ensuring optimal returns for investors. To embark on this career path, individuals typically need a strong academic background in finance, real estate, or business administration. Pursuing a bachelor's degree is essential, followed by potential specialization through master's programs or certifications in real estate investment. Gaining practical experience through internships, real estate firms, or investment funds enhances employability. Networking with professionals in the field and staying updated with market trends and investment strategies are also crucial. With a blend of education, experience, and a passion for real estate, one can build a rewarding career dedicated to managing real estate investments.

Career in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ator

Typically, a bachelor's degree in finance, real estate, or business administration is required, with advanced degrees or certifications often preferred for senior roles.

Key skills include financial analysis, market research, negotiation, and strong communication skills, which are vital for managing investments and liaising with stakeholders.

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ators often work in office settings but may also conduct site visits to properties, requiring a mix of desk work and fieldwork.

Salaries vary widely based on experience, education, and location, with entry-level positions starting around $60,000 and experienced professionals earning over $120,000 annually.

Related careers include Real Estate Analyst, Property Manager, and Investment Advisor, each focusing on different aspects of real estate investment and management.

What are the roles and responsibilities in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ator?

  • Conducting Market Research :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ators analyze market trends, property values, and economic factors to identify investment opportunities.
  • Financial Analysis : They assess financial data and projections to evaluate the potential return on investment for various real estate assets.
  • Managing Investor Relations :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ators maintain communication with investors, providing updates on fund performance and investment strategies.
  • Developing Investment Strategies : They formulate strategies for acquiring, managing, and disposing of real estate assets to maximize returns.
  • Compliance and Reporting : Ensuring adherence to regulatory requirements and preparing reports for stakeholders regarding fund performance and compliance.

What are the key skills required for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ator

  • Financial Analysis Skills - These skills are crucial for evaluating investment opportunities and making informed financial decisions.
  • Communication Skills - Effective communication is vital for presenting investment strategies and maintaining investor relations.
  • Negotiation Skills - The ability to negotiate deals and contracts is essential for securing favorable terms in real estate transactions.
  • Analytical Skills - Proficiency in analyzing market data and trends to identify investment opportunities is important.
  • Project Management Skills - Managing real estate projects efficiently, including budgeting and timelines, is key to successful outcomes in real estate investment.

What are the career opportunities in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ator?

  • Real Estate Analyst - Real Estate Analysts assess property values and market trends to support investment decisions.
  • Property Manager - Property Managers oversee the operation and management of real estate properties, enhancing their value and profitability.
  • Investment Advisor - Investment Advisors provide guidance to clients on real estate investments and portfolio management.
  • Portfolio Manager - Portfolio Managers are responsible for managing a collection of real estate assets to achieve investment goals.
  • Acquisition Manager - Acquisition Managers focus on identifying and acquiring new real estate investments for funds or companies.

What is the salary and demand for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ator?

  • Salary Overview - The typical salary for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ators ranges from $60,000 for entry-level positions to over $120,000 for experienced professionals, with variations based on education and location.
  • Regional Salary Variations - Salaries can vary significantly by region; for example, coordinators in metropolitan areas may earn more than those in rural settings.
  • Current Job Market Demand - The demand for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ators is growing due to increasing investment activities and the need for effective property management.
  • Future Demand Projections - Future demand for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ators is expected to rise as real estate markets expand and investment opportunities increase.

Pros & Cons of a Career in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inator

Pros

  • Real Estate Investment Fund Coordinators play a crucial role in managing investments, making their work impactful and rewarding.
  • The field offers competitive salaries, especially for those with advanced degrees and specialized skills.
  • Professionals in this field contribute to economic growth and development through effective real estate management.
  • The career provides opportunities for continuous learning and advancement in a dynamic and evolving market.

Cons

  • The job can be demanding with long hours, especially during peak investment periods or when conducting property evaluations.
  • Some roles may require extensive travel to various real estate locations, which can be physically taxing.
  • Market fluctuations can lead to job instability or pressure to meet investment performance targets.
  • The work can sometimes be isolating, especially when engaged in extensive data analysis or research.
